pedagogical sciences or pedagogics? Sun Apr 20, 2008 1:20 am  pedagogical sciences or pedagogics?
 

Hello everyone

I'd like to ask which phrase sounds more natural for native English speakers as an academic degree -- Dr. of pedagogical sciences, or Dr. of pedagogics. Or there is no difference between them?

Ms Google finds both in about equal measure-- but they are all mainly in Russia: obviously a Russian specialty. I would think that there is little difference in breadth of field.

I think pedagogics is a very common socialist or post-socialist countries and it's a mix of communist ideology and some basic concepts of psychology. In western countries they call this major 'education'.
